Description

More than 50 extraordinary female Super Heroes from the DC Universe encourage and embolden young girls to be courageous, compassionate and capable. Shining a spotlight on characters such as Batwoman, Huntressand Zatanna, Brave and Bold! is a one-of-a-kind book that will delight young DC fans, and inspire comic book writers and artists of the future. From Wonder Woman and Batgirl to Bumblebee and Supergirl, DK's stunning book Brave and Bold! celebrates DC's most powerful, daring and groundbreaking female Super Heroes. Illustrated with exquisite comic book artwork by some of the industry's finest talents, each hero's profile is carefully curated to focus on the character's abilities, strengths and achievements. Wonder Woman broke the mould, paving the way for a myriad of female characters to take their place amongst the ranks of DC's greatest Super Heroes. Soon the likes of Batman, Superman, The Flash and Aquaman were sharing the limelight with Supergirl, Lois Lane and Catwoman. Now these fan favourites join other DC Super Heroes Batwoman, Hawkgirl, Black Canary, Bumblebee and many others, to take centre stage in Brave and Bold! - a shining tribute to the female heroes of the DC Universe. . & DC Comics. Author Biography:

Sam Maggs is a bestselling writer of books, comics, and video games. She's a Senior Writer for Insomniac Games; the author of Quirk Books' THE FANGIRL'S GUIDE TO THE GALAXY, WONDER WOMEN, and GIRL SQUADS (Oct. 2018); and she's written for comics like STAR TREK and JEM & THE HOLOGRAMS. A Canadian in Los Angeles, she misses Coffee Crisp and bagged milk. Gail Simone is an award-winning author of comics and animation who has written acclaimed comic book runs on characters like Batgirl, Wonder Woman, and Deadpool, as well as animation as diverse as Justice League Unlimited and My Little Pony. She is a fierce advocate for diversity in media.
